Rob Clark
7f9039f0a8
freedreno/ir3: DCE unused arrays
...
Letting unused arrays stick around confuses RA, which assigns vreg names
to the unused arrays, but then does not precolor them (because they are
unused). This leads to an assert in ra_select_reg_merged():
skqp: ../src/freedreno/ir3/ir3_ra.c:589: name_to_instr: Assertion '!name_is_array(ctx, name)' failed.
Closes: https://gitlab.freedesktop.org/mesa/mesa/-/issues/3262

Mike Blumenkrantz
5e9cd64f70
zink: enable tgsi texcoord pipe cap
...
this requires some modifications to the ntv slot remapping, as we definitely
don't want to reserve another 25% of the available slots for the (deprecated)
texcoord varyings
now we remap VARYING_SLOT_TEX[n] to the last available slots, which lets us avoid
needing to do permanent reservation, and we check to make sure that we haven't
seen the corresponding texcoord varying any time we emit a non-texcoord varying in
that slot

Jonathan Marek
f37f1a1a64
turnip: remove use of tu_cs_entry for draw states
...
The tu_cs_entry struct doesn't match well what we want for SET_DRAW_STATE
and CP_INDIRECT_BUFFER (requires extra steps to get iova and size), so
start phasing it out.
Additionally, use newly added tu_cs_draw_state where it doesn't require any
effort (it requires a fixed size, but gets rid of the extra end_sub_stream)
Note this also changes the behavior of CmdBindDescriptorSets for compute to
emit directly in cmd->cs instead of doing through a CP_INDIRECT.
